This second edition of a landmark reference resource - created not only for psychologists, clinicians, students, and professionals from allied mental health professions, but for all interested readers - offers definitive information on the lexicon of the field, including
- Almost 2 , entries offering clear and authoritative definitions - approximately , more than the first edition
- Balanced coverage of 9 subareas, with significantly revised and expanded content especially in the areas of neuroscience, psychopharmacology, lifespan developmental psychology, statistics, experimental design, and many others
- Thousands of incisive cross-references that deepen the user's comprehension of related topics
- More than 4 brief biographical entries on historical figures in psychology and other related areas - four times more than the first edition
- A Guide to the Dictionary and a Quick Guide to Format that explain stylistic and format features
- Three appendixes: Institutional and Organizational Entries Psychological Test and Assessment Instrument Entries Psychotherapeutic Techniques, Biological Treatments, and Related Entries
